  • Page 6: Introduction

    1. INTRODUCTION The Digital Audio Converter with Dual Outputs will convert between Coaxial and Optical digital audio formats. This compact and convenient unit accepts a stereo or surround (up to 5.1 channels) audio signal through either Coaxial cable or Optical cable, and passes the unchanged signal to both its Coaxial and Optical output ports.
  • Page 7: Operation Controls And Functions

    6. OPERATION CONTROLS AND FUNCTIONS 6.1 Front Panel Coax Toslink Coaxial In: Connect to the output of an S/PDIF digital audio source device such as DVD player or set-top box, using Coaxial cable. Toslink In: Connect to the output of an S/PDIF digital audio source device such as CD player or Media Streamer, using Optical cable.
  • Page 8: Left Panel

    6.3 Left Panel Coaxial DC 5V Tos/Coaxial: Selects the current audio source, either optical or coaxial. DC 5V: Connect the 5V DC power supply to the unit and plug the adaptor into an AC wall outlet. 6.4 Top Panel POWER LED: The LED will illuminate when the power is connected.

  • Page 10: Specifications

    8. SPECIFICATIONS Input Ports 1×Coaxial (RCA connector) 1×Optical Fiber (TOSLINK connector) Input Format LPCM 2 CH, Compressed audio Dolby Digital 2/5.1 CH & DTS 2/5.1 CH Output Ports 1×Coaxial (RCA connector) 1×Optical Fiber (TOSLINK connector) Power Supply 5 V/1.2 A switching power adaptor (with universal plug, CE/FCC/UL certified) Dimensions 58 mm (W)×46 mm (D)×24 mm (H)
